When a girl is given a coin to spend at the market, she thinks carefully about what to buy. She is tempted by the towering stacks of fruit, spinning rides and glass jars filled with sweets. But it isn't until a stranger gives something to her, without expecting anything in return, that she knows exactly what to do with her coin. A story brimming with joy, generosity and magic from two of Australia's beloved picture book creators. Carrie Gallasch's beautiful text evokes the warmth and community of the market, while Hannah Sommerville brings this glorious world to life with rich colour and texture.

The story explores the bond between Adeline and her cherished Bunnybear, whose damage leads to feelings of loss and change. After Nanna repairs Bunnybear, he becomes stiff and unrecognizable, prompting Adeline to abandon him. However, when Nanna leaves, Adeline discovers that true connection transcends physical form; it is love that truly binds them. This poignant tale highlights themes of attachment, healing, and the enduring nature of love.
